是的,CentOS Stream(包括当前主流的 CentOS Stream 9 和未来的 CentOS Stream 10)可以安装 GNOME 或 KDE 桌面环境,但需注意以下关键点:
✅ GNOME 是官方默认且完全支持的桌面环境
- CentOS Stream 9 基于 RHEL 9,而 RHEL 9 的官方唯一支持的图形桌面是 GNOME 40+(默认为 GNOME 40.9,随系统更新升级)。
- 安装时可选择 “Server with GUI” 镜像,或在最小安装后通过
dnf groupinstall "Server with GUI"安装完整 GNOME 桌面(含 GDM、Wayland/X11 支持、控制中心等)。 - GNOME 在 CentOS Stream 上经过 Red Hat 全面测试和维护,稳定性与安全性有保障。
⚠️ KDE Plasma(KDE Desktop)可安装,但属于“社区支持”而非“Red Hat 官方支持”
- KDE Plasma 并未被 Red Hat 列入 RHEL/CentOS Stream 的上游支持范围(即不提供 SLA、不保证长期兼容性、不作为默认选项预集成)。
- 但技术上完全可行:可通过 EPEL(Extra Packages for Enterprise Linux)仓库安装:
sudo dnf install epel-release -y sudo dnf groupinstall "KDE Plasma Workspaces" -y sudo systemctl set-default graphical.target sudo systemctl reboot - ✅ 功能正常(窗口管理、应用、设置等),适合日常桌面使用;
- ⚠️ 注意:
- KDE 包由 EPEL 社区维护,更新节奏可能略慢于 GNOME;
- 某些企业级功能(如 SSSD 集成登录、FIPS 模式兼容性)可能不如 GNOME 经过充分验证;
- 若用于生产环境(尤其涉及合规/审计要求),建议优先选用 GNOME。
🔧 补充说明:
- X11 vs Wayland:CentOS Stream 9 默认启用 Wayland(GNOME),KDE Plasma 也支持 Wayland(但部分旧驱动/硬件可能需回退到 X11)。
- 显卡驱动:开源驱动(Intel/AMD)开箱即用;NVIDIA 闭源驱动需手动安装(推荐使用
akmod-nvidia+ EPEL + RPM Fusion,非官方仓库)。 - 资源占用:GNOME 和 KDE 均属现代重型桌面,建议至少 2GB 内存 + 2 核 CPU;轻量替代方案可选 XFCE(
@xfce-desktop-environment)或 LXQt。
| 📌 总结: | 桌面环境 | 是否可安装 | 官方支持 | 推荐场景 |
|---|---|---|---|---|
| GNOME | ✅ 是(默认) | ✅ Red Hat 全面支持 | 生产服务器带 GUI、远程管理、合规环境 | |
| KDE Plasma | ✅ 是(需 EPEL) | ❌ 社区支持(非 Red Hat SLA) | 个人工作站、开发者桌面、偏好 KDE 生态 |
💡 提示:若用于服务器管理,建议仅在必要时启用 GUI(如需 Web 控制台 cockpit、图形化监控工具),多数运维任务仍推荐 CLI + SSH + Web UI(如 Cockpit)以提升安全性和性能。
需要具体安装命令或故障排查(如登录循环、黑屏、GDM 启动失败等),欢迎继续提问!
云知识CLOUD